With more than 5,600 subscribers, aftermarketNews (AMN) targets the news and informational needs of top-level executives and managers throughout the $255-billion automotive aftermarket. AMN reaches key decision-makers at more than 3,000 of the top aftermarket companies and www.aftermarketnews.com generates approximately 70,000 page views each month.

For more than a decade, AMN has focused on presenting the most current and relevant aftermarket industry business news in an easy-to-digest online format.

Daily news coverage centers on the important events taking place across all segments of the automotive aftermarket — from manufacturing and distribution to collision and heavy duty — covering a wide range of topics such as mergers and acquisitions, financial reporting, personnel and new product announcements and legislation that impacts the industry. Special features such as AMN’s exclusive Executive Interview articles published each Monday put industry leaders in the spotlight to capture their views and insights on important industry issues. Key industry market data from research leaders including Babcox, IMR and TLG is highlighted every Friday in “The Pulse.”

Other regular features including Opinion and Guest Commentary columns offer up unique insight and analysis from our experienced editorial staff and contributors. The AMN Data Center offers access to popular directories such as the AASA Top 100 Aftermarket Suppliers list, our Manufacturer’s Rep Directory, Aftermarket Association Directory and other helpful lists. New additions such as the AMN Stock Index and Careers page round out AMN’s comprehensive offering of industry-specific tools and information.

In addition to a robust, stand-alone website, the AMN electronic newsletter is e-mailed to our subscribers each business day and features 11 of the day’s most critical news stories. The AMN Week in Review – our useful and concise wrap-up of the week’s top news – is e-mailed at the end of each business week. “Breaking News” bulletins are issued for hot news stories as they happen. In addition, every year the editorial staff of aftermarketNews presents “The Year in Review” – an in-depth look at the most popular news stories published on AMN that year. Subscribers have the option to customize their subscriptions online to meet their individual information needs.

Social media also plays a significant part in our editorial coverage, and the AMN Twitter and Facebook feeds offer two more convenient ways to access information and get involved in the dialogue.

Known as a consistent, reliable and trusted resource, AMN’s mission remains the same while our format constantly evolves to meet the needs of this ever-changing marketplace.
